In the cutting-edge world of artificial intelligence, Alibaba Group is blazing a trail that investors are eagerly following. As the AI landscape evolves at lightning speed, Alibaba has launched its powerful Qwen 2.5 AI model, enhancing customer experience with sophisticated text generation and natural language abilities. This development isn’t just a leap in technology; it’s a strategic move to bolster their e-commerce empire through intelligent, personalized interactions.
Yet, the plot thickens with the entrance of DeepSeek, a bold newcomer offering cost-effective AI models. By making AI accessible, DeepSeek is leveling the playing field, enabling even smaller businesses to harness the power of AI. This competition injects fresh excitement into the industry, promising innovation that could disrupt traditional norms.
The market reacts positively to these advancements, with Alibaba’s shares surging 13%, reflecting a vote of confidence in its growth potential. Analysts highlight the pressing need for a robust monetization strategy to sustain this momentum, indicating that a clear path to revenue is key amidst the AI frenzy.

2. What sets newcomer DeepSeek apart in the AI landscape?
DeepSeek distinguishes itself with its commitment to democratizing AI technology. Offering cost-effective AI models, DeepSeek makes it feasible for smaller businesses to employ sophisticated AI capabilities without the hefty costs typically associated with such technology. This approach not only levels the playing field but also invites innovation by enabling a broader range of businesses to participate in the AI revolution, potentially disrupting established industry norms.
